Opening of the Victoria Memorial Hall, Calcutta. The Prince declaring the Memorial open. Seated on either side are the Earl and Countess of Ronaldshay. (December 27th, 1921.)
Opening of the Victoria Memorial Hall, Calcutta. The Earl of Ronaldshay addressing H.R.H. on behalf of the Trustees. The Prince and Countess of Ronaldshay are seen seated (centre). (December 28th, 1921.)
Opening of the Victoria Memorial Hall, Calcutta. The Prince and Earl of Ronaldshay passing through the distinguished gathering assembled for the ceremony. (December 28th, 1921.)
The Prince unveils the Calcutta War Memorial. H.R.H. walking round the Cenotaph, accompanied by the President of the Memorial Committee, Calcutta. (December 30th, 1921.)
The Burmese Ode in illuminated form being handed to H.R.H. by one of the Principals of the University. On left is the Chancellor. Rangoon. (January 2nd, 1922.)
The Prince acknowledging cheers of guests. Following H.R.H. is the Governor – Sir Reginald Craddock and Lady Craddock. Garden Party at Government House. Rangoon. (January 3rd, 1922.)
